On May 11, the Folsom City Council
voted to approve the Lot Y Hotel at Folsom Boulevard and US 50 by a
3 - 2 vote.
Voting to
approve the Hotel as proposed,
were Mayor Starsky, Vice Mayor Morein and Council Member Miklos.
Voting against
the hotel development
were Council Members Howell and Sheldon.
HPL and partner organizations are considering
possible next steps.
